Given the rural roads and seasonal weather around Henderson County, common repairs include 4WD system servicing, suspension component replacement due to rough terrain, and addressing rust or corrosion from winter road treatments. Jeeps also frequently need attention for steering components like tie rods and ball joints after navigating local gravel and uneven country roads.

You should have the 4WD system inspected if you notice difficulty engaging/disengaging 4WD, unusual noises from the drivetrain, or before the onset of winter. Proactive service before the muddy spring seasons and snowy winters around Biggsville is crucial for safe travel on rural roads and farm access lanes.

The combination of gravel country roads, agricultural traffic, and winter salt/brine on routes like IL-164 and US-34 means you should adhere to a strict maintenance schedule. Focus on more frequent undercarriage inspections for rust, tire rotations/alignments due to uneven surfaces, and air filter changes because of dust from rural and farming areas.
